Choosing Your Destinations

Embarking on a multi-day European family adventure offers a plethora of destinations, each boasting unique experiences that cater to both children and adults. When planning, it's essential to select locations that provide a blend of culture, history, and family-friendly activities. Consider destinations like Paris for its iconic landmarks, Barcelona for its vibrant culture, and Munich for its rich history.

Creating a Flexible Itinerary

While having a plan is crucial, flexibility is key to a successful family trip. Allow room for spontaneous adventures and rest days. A well-balanced itinerary might include structured tours and free time to explore. Remember to account for travel time between destinations and consider purchasing a rail pass for efficient travel.

Accommodation Options

Choosing the right accommodation can greatly enhance your family’s comfort. Options range from family-friendly hotels with amenities like pools and play areas to vacation rentals offering more space and a home-like atmosphere. Consider staying in central locations to minimize travel time to major attractions.

Engaging Activities for All Ages

Europe offers countless activities that entertain all ages. In Paris, take a day to explore Disneyland Paris or cruise along the Seine. Barcelona’s beaches and parks are perfect for relaxation, while Munich's interactive museums offer educational fun. Ensure that each family member has something to look forward to daily.

Packing Essentials

Packing smart is essential for any family adventure. Focus on versatile clothing suitable for varying weather and comfortable footwear for long days of exploration. Don’t forget essentials like travel-sized toiletries, snacks, and entertainment options for the kids during transit.

Dining with Family

European cuisine is diverse and delicious, offering something for every palate. In Italy, indulge in authentic pizzas and pastas; in France, sample regional cheeses and pastries. Many restaurants offer kid-friendly menus, but it's also worth visiting local markets for fresh produce and picnic supplies.

Safety and Health Considerations

Ensuring the health and safety of your family is paramount. Before traveling, check travel advisories and health recommendations for your chosen destinations. Carry a basic first-aid kit, and ensure everyone in the family has health insurance coverage that includes international travel.
